Transaction 3c8b5ab26a5254f29de3e9f0a36189b5846f8058f2333a63def8040cfa4beff2
1 Input
1 Output
-
3c8b5ab26a5254f29de3e9f0a36189b5846f8058f2333a63def8040cfa4beff2:0
- value
- 63836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3c64cade72858eee2d7e97703d5aba3bb2df650 OP_EQUAL
- address
- 3J5aRyTRZJ9oVzmRp9ynhF1rwX5SYeyHTQ